From ca3fb258bf9665cbac08c635e3f8619a03f64226 Mon Sep 17 00:00:00 2001 From: bogdan Date: Tue, 8 Oct 2019 04:19:00 +0300 Subject: [PATCH] [HttpKernel] fix $dotenvVars in data collector --- .../HttpKernel/DataCollector/RequestDataCollector.php |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/Symfony/Component/HttpKernel/DataCollector/RequestDataCollector.php b/src/Symfony/Component/HttpKernel/DataCollector/RequestDataCollector.php index 32624c963fa07..3f6150ba9fddf 100644 --- a/src/Symfony/Component/HttpKernel/DataCollector/RequestDataCollector.php +++ b/src/Symfony/Component/HttpKernel/DataCollector/RequestDataCollector.php @@ -80,9 +80,9 @@ public function collect(Request $request, Response $response, \Exception $except } $dotenvVars = []; - foreach (explode(',', getenv('SYMFONY_DOTENV_VARS')) as $name) { - if ('' !== $name && false !== $value = getenv($name)) { - $dotenvVars[$name] = $value; + foreach (explode(',', $_SERVER['SYMFONY_DOTENV_VARS'] ?? $_ENV['SYMFONY_DOTENV_VARS'] ?? '') as $name) { + if ('' !== $name && isset($_ENV[$name])) { + $dotenvVars[$name] = $_ENV[$name]; } }